Sue Scheff: Teen Pregnancy - Stay Teen

Every day, more than 2,000 teen girls in the United States get pregnant. In fact, 3 in 10 girls will become pregnant by age 20. Not having sex is the only sure way to avoid pregnancy, though there are a lot of other good reasons to wait, too. But if you're having sex, you must use birth control carefully and correctly every single time you do.

The best time to think about how you would handle a risky situation is before you're in it. Will you say no? If so, how will you say it? And if you do go all the way, how will you protect yourself and your future?
